MLX plays a key role in lipid and glucose metabolism in humans: evidence from in vitro and in vivo studies
<p><strong>Background and aim</strong></p> Enhanced hepatic de novo lipogenesis (DNL) has been proposed as an underlying mechanism for the development of NAFLD and insulin resistance. Max-like protein factor X (MLX) acts as a heterodimer binding partner for glucose sensing t...
